CAUGHT ON VIDEO! Peace Officer Discharges Weapon Into Air At Windward Passage Hotel

CHARLOTTE AMALIE — Police say they are investigating a peace officer who fired a gun into the air to try to break up a fight outside the Windward Passage Hotel on Monday night.

Virgin Islands Police Commissioner Delroy Richards Sr. said he was aware of the situation after being provided with a copy of a cellphone video captured by a bystander.

The three minute, forty-four second video earned the officer who perpetrated the shooting a drubbing on social media for not using more conventional means to try to stop the fight.

“I’m glad you recorded,” an unidentified woman’s voice says on the video. “Keep recording.”

The video shows a fight that took place outside of the hotel which is on the waterfront in Charlotte Amalie as a group of people stand in the public parking lot watching as the chaotic scene unfolds.

Richards said the person who fired the shot is a peace officer, but not a Virgin Islands Police Department officer.

According to police records, dispatchers dispatched VIPD officers to Wendy’s restaurant, rather than Windward Passage Hotel, leaving the peace officer stranded by himself at the fight.

“All ah police jokee, VIPD gotta go!” a woman is heard saying in the background of the video as the formerly unoccupied public safety van pulls into the parking lot and people begin to disperse.
